Add 45/70 and 3/6
45/70 + 3/6 is 8/7.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 70 and 6 is 210
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 210 - For the 1st fraction, since 70 × 3 = 210,
45/70 = 45 × 3/70 × 3 = 135/210 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 6 × 35 = 210,
3/6 = 3 × 35/6 × 35 = 105/210 - Add the two like fractions:
135/210 + 105/210 = 135 + 105/210 = 240/210 - 240/210 simplified gives 8/7
- So, 45/70 + 3/6 = 8/7
In mixed form: 11/7
